If New Zealand is not 1st in the world in sport we as a nation are in despair
- - goodness sometimes we have to put up with 2nd or even 3rd!

Why oh why then do we so easily and gutlessly accept a ranking of 40th on the world economic scale or 22nd on the OECD rankings?

To quote a visiting South American agricultural expert recently
‘Don’t New Zealanders realise how fast the world is changing?’

Government spending has increased by $25 Billion in the last eight years.
After inflation real Government spending has increased by a whopping $15 Billion per year
This extravagant spending burdens every family in New Zealand with an extra cost of $200 per week

According to a recent Treasury analysis this staggering spending growth produced ‘no discernible net benefit’

It doesn’t stop there!!
Poor quality government spending is the main cause of inflation
This causes our mortgage interest rates to be at least 3.5% higher than if we were a well run economy.
The extra cost on every $200,000 mortgage is a further $100 per week.

Greece has just whizzed past New Zealand on the OECD rankings where we now rank a miserly 22nd.

If we were a State in Australia we would poorer than the poorest State (Tasmania) by $100 per week per person

If we were a State in the USA we would be 51st (and last) - $120 a week poorer than Mississippi!!
